Climbing in El Chaltén is a few of the greatest in Argentina, Patagonia. The Laguna Torre hike in Los Glaciares Nationwide Park is without doubt one of the hottest trails from El Chaltén. Also called the Cerro Torre hike the path leads from the trailhead within the city of El Chalten to Laguna Torre a novel glacial lake on the base of Cerro Torre. This isn’t a blue glacial lake, however a muddy, brown lake. Views are lovely although and floating icebergs that broke off from the Torre glacier are fairly spectacular.

Laguna Torre (Cerro Torre) Path Route Overview 

  • Whole distance – 18km (11 miles), out and again hike 9 km to the endpoint, can lengthen to 20 km (12.5 miles) with Mirador Maestri facet journey
  • Time – 5 – 6 hours
  • Whole ascent – 500 m
  • Problem – Average
  • Value – Free
  • Start line – Laguna Torre trailhead on the finish of Los Charitos road
  • Ending level – Out and again path (El Chalten – Mirador Cascada Margarita – Agostini campground – Laguna Torre – El Chalten)
  • Strolling route – El Chalten, Mirador Torre, Laguna Torre, El Chalten

The place does the Laguna Torre path begin?

You can begin strolling to the Laguna Torre primary path out of your lodging wherever within the small city of El Chaltén.

The town El Chalten, Argentina's trekking capital
The Laguna Torre hike begins within the city of El Chalten, usually known as Argentina’s trekking capital

The official trailhead to the Laguna Torre hike is on the finish of Los Charitos Road, there may be truly an indication indicating the beginning of the “Senda a Laguna Torre”.

GPS pin for Laguna Torre trailhead. There are two trailheads to Laguna Torre on the town, the paths merge after a brief stroll, so you can begin at any. 

Laguna Torre Route Description

Stroll to Mirador Cascada Margarita

The Laguna Torre path begins with an incline, it’s a average uphill climb for the primary  2 km (1.2 miles) till you attain Mirador Margarita after about 20 minutes of strolling. That is the primary viewpoint that gives good panoramic views of the Adela vary, Cerro Torre, the Margarita waterfall lies throughout the river canyon. From right here on it will get simpler. Stroll by means of the valley of demise and rebirth alongside a boardwalk.

Mirador Cerro Torre

Proceed on the path for two kilometers to Mirador Cerro Torre with some elevation achieve. Right here there are some good views of the Cerro Torre mountain vary.

Laguna Torre

Strolling subsequent to the roaring Fitz Roy River (Rio Fitz Roy) you’ll attain Laguna Torre after mountaineering for an additional 7 kilometers (4.Four miles) on a comparatively flat path strolling previous a number of panoramic viewpoints overlooking Cerro Solo, Cordón Adela, and Cerro Torre. The D’Agostini campground is situated on the path a brief distance earlier than Laguna Torre. 

Icebergs floating in a brown color Laguna Torre
Laguna Torre is well-known for the big icebergs floating within the lake and the great views of Cerro Torre within the background.

Strolling to Laguna Torre takes about three hours from El Chalten and the way in which again is a bit faster since it’s extra downhill. The path to Laguna Torre may be very well-marked and simple to observe.

Stroll to Mirador Maestri

Once you attain the lake you’ll be able to proceed to a different viewpoint,  the Maestri viewpoint is a couple of kilometer away. This half is a difficult hike on a slim, rocky path.  It’s a laborious a part of the hike on uneven terrain. 

Tenting at Laguna Torre

There are just a few choices for tenting whereas mountaineering to Laguna Torre made potential by the de Agostini campgrounds and Campamento Pointcenot. Each these campsites are free and no reserving is important.

De Agostini Campgrounds – experience dawn 

The de Agostini campsite is situated in a dense forest of tall bushes on the base of Laguna Torre. The placement is a good spot to do the ultimate push early within the morning or within the night and catch the sundown or dawn on the lake whereas tenting right here. In the summertime months, sundown is after 22:00 and you may stroll to the lake from the campsite for this experience. Dawn is incredible right here for taking photographs and it’s positively value it to camp right here and rise up early to catch the dawn. 

Hike the Laguna de Los Tres and Laguna Torre three Day Loop

For an actual journey see each Laguna de Los Tres and Laguna Torre whereas tenting for two nights in Los Glaciares Nationwide Park strolling from El Chaltén. 

  • A 38 km (24 miles) loop 
  • Strolling route – El Chalten, Rió de Las Vueltas Mirador, Mirador Fitz Roy, Poincenot campground, Laguna de Los Tres, (Facet Journey to Piedras Blancas Glacier Viewpoint), Laguna Torre, Tenting de Agostini, Mirador del Torre, El Chalten
Campbell and Alya at Laguna de Los Tres
On the lovely glacier-fed lake Laguna de Los Tres with spectacular views of Mt Fitzroy, we proceed to Laguna Torre.

Day 1 stroll from El Chalten to Campamento Pointcenot  (eight km) – Begin the hike on the trailhead simply exterior city on the parking space on the finish of Avenida San Martín. Register right here if you will camp. Registration is free. Arrange camp and spend the night time in Campamento Pointcenot. 

Day 2 an early begin to Laguna de Los Tres (2km). Placed on some heat clothes. See dawn on the spectacular Laguna de Los Tres, don´t miss the spectacular Laguna Succi solely half a mile away.  From right here stroll one other 19 km hike to the Agostini campsite. The space between the Pointcenot and Agostini campsites is 17 kilometers. We left our tent in Pointcenot and walked again earlier than persevering with to Laguna Torre. On this route, the Piedras Blancas Glacier Viewpoint is a 5 km detour. This glacier is without doubt one of the greatest viewpoints on this lengthy hike. If a 24 km day hike is just too lengthy you’ll be able to all the time return to Pointcenot campsite for an additional night time after seeing the Piedras Blancas Glacier.

Day three Catch the dawn at Laguna Torre from the Agostini campsite and stroll again the ultimate 9 km to El Chalten.

How tough is the Laguna Torre Path?

The 18 km spherical journey hike is comparatively simple and flat virtually all the way in which. The preliminary 2 kilometers (1.2 miles) is a bit difficult. Aside from that the climb to Mirador Maestri is difficult on a slim uneven path. 

Greatest Time To Do the Cerro Torre Hike

El Chalten could be visited all 12 months spherical. The height season for mountaineering is in the summertime months from October to April. One of the best climate is from December to March with larger temperatures. The path will get very busy in peak season and robust winds could make tenting a bit more durable.

Shoulder season, November and April, is an efficient time to keep away from the big crowds and the climate remains to be good for mountaineering. You’ll be able to nonetheless have unhealthy luck with wind, rain, and chilly climate.

In winter from June to September, it may be chilly, the wind is much less, however the trails could be inaccessible due to snow or it may be slippery on account of ice.

Get to El Chalten

The closest airport is El Calafate 220km away. Getting right here from Buenos Aires is straightforward by aircraft or bus. There’s a day by day bus between El Calafate and El Chaltén it departs all 12 months spherical, twice per day morning and night (three instances within the peak season). The journey takes about three hours.  Chalten Journey is a well-liked bus service to make use of.
